(The Hosting News) – Internetters, one of the leading providers of domain names, web hosting and email services in the UK, has this week announced significant enhancements to its range of shared hosting solutions
Of the main enhancements to the Internetters web hosting range, perhaps the most significant is the move to unlimited bandwidth, bringing that particular element back in line with many competitors on the market. With varying degrees of bandwidth usage previously available depending on hosting package, customers buying any of the four web hosting packages will now receive unlimited bandwidth usage.
In addition, the management of MySQL databases has been improved, with easier upgrade channels, faster provisioning and reduced pricing making it easier for customers to expand their database driven websites.
“The fact that we’ve been making some significant improvements to our service is no secret after recent announcements in relation to our domain names, our VPS partnership and the general makeover of the website.” Comments Errol Vanderhorst, Managing Director at Internetters.
“It was the turn of web hosting this time and the inclusion of unlimited bandwidth and upgrades to MySQL management are just the start of a process that will see several new features and upgrades introduced in the coming months”
Internetters is an established UK based web service provider offering domain names, web hosting and email services to suit the requirements of both consumers and businesses throughout the UK and beyond. A variety of recent service updates has seen a positive reaction from its global customer base and the company continues to put together plans for further improvement to cement its position as one of the leading providers in the UK.
Errol continued, “The web hosting and domain names markets are incredibly competitive in the UK and beyond, and our changes are focused on making sure the brand continually stays competitive, both in terms of generating new custom and in making sure our current customer base is happy.”

Scottsdale, Arizona – (The Hosting News) – July 21, 2009 – The GoDaddy.com web hosting and domain registrar company is hiring technically skilled Spanish speakers to better serve its global customers currently.
At a news conference held at its Tempe, Ariz. facility today, Go Daddy Vice President of Customer Care Miguel Lopez announced 20 open positions in the Spanish language unit. Lopez is a native Spanish speaker himself, and oversees all Go Daddy’s Customer Care operations.
The newly formed team services Spanish speaking customers who want help setting up their online presence, with domain names, Web sites, e-commerce tools, blogs, photo albums or any of the 52 products Go Daddy offers.
Mr. Lopez explained, “We are looking for Spanish speakers with computer knowledge, but we also train our staff so they know our products and services inside and out. Since we began offering Spanish language assistance this year, we’ve seen a significant spike in business from Mexico and Spain. So few companies actually offer a phone number for top-notch customer service … clearly, there is a need for people to have access to friendly, knowledgeable service when it comes to getting up and running on the Internet.”
Go Daddy is one of a handful of Inc. 500/5000 companies in hiring mode these days. The Web giant employs more than 2,170 people, and serves more than 7 million customers worldwide.
In addition to the Spanish speaking positions, Go Daddy has 100 open jobs right now.
The Scottsdale-based company ranked on the Valley’s Best Places to Work list for the last five years running. Other distinguished honors and awards over recent years include Go Daddy being selected Most Innovative Company, Business Leader of the Year, Best Registrar, Best Employee Perks and Best Manufacturing and Technology company in the Valley.
Go Daddy offers outstanding health benefits, generous vacation time, competitive salaries, educational assistance and opportunities to advance.
Go Daddy is a leading provider of services that enable individuals and businesses to establish, maintain and evolve an online presence. Go Daddy provides a variety of domain name registration plans and Web site design and hosting packages, as well as a broad array of on-demand services. These include products such as SSL Certificates, Domains by Proxy private registration, ecommerce Web site hosting, blog templates and blog software, podcast packages and online photo hosting. The Go Daddy Group, Inc. has more than 35 million domain names under management. Go Daddy registers, renews or transfers a domain name every second. GoDaddy.com is the world’s No. 1 domain name registrar according to Name Intelligence, Inc. GoDaddy.com is also rated the world’s largest hostname provider according to Netcraft Ltd. During 2008, The Go Daddy Group registered more than one-third of all new domain names created in the top six generic top-level domains, or gTLDs, including .com, .net, .org, .info, .biz and .mobi.
